老卫带你学—github访问下载慢
老卫最近下载github上的源码特别的慢,从网上查找很多的资料之后,找了以下的解决方法。
windows下:
- 打开C:\Windows\System32\drivers\etc\hosts文件。
- 访问ipaddress网站https://www.ipaddress.com/,查看网站对应的IP地址,输入网址则可查阅到对应的IP地址,这是一个查询域名映射关系的工具。
- 查询 github.global.ssl.fastly.net 和 github.com 以及codeload.github.com三个地址。
- 多查几次,选择一个稳定,延迟较低的 ip 按如下方式添加到host文件的最后面。
比如我的如下:
151.101.44.249 github.global.ssl.fastly.net
192.30.253.113 github.com
192.30.253.113 www.github.com
192.30.253.120 codeload.github.com
- 保存hosts文件
- 进入cmd中,输入命令,重启浏览器。
ipconfig /flushdns
linux/ubuntu下:
- mac/linux系统的hosts文件的位置在/etc/hosts
- 其他做法与windows下一样。
- 最后执行命令的时候,linux/mac执行命令
sudo /etc/init.d/networking restart